Women's Basketball Routs NEC to Close Out Regular Season

Women's Basketball Routs NEC to Close Out Regular Season

NEW HAVEN, Conn. — In the final seconds of the first half, Jakara Murray-Leach (Norwalk, Conn.) connected for a mid-range jumper and snapped the game's final tie as Albertus Magnus College women's basketball maintained that lead until the final buzzer. The Falcons outlasted Great Northeast Athletic Conference (GNAC) opponent New England College, 68-59, to close out the regular season. Albertus finished third in the GNAC with an 11-3 conference record, while the Pilgrims sat sixth with an 8-6 GNAC record.

A quartet of Falcons mustered double-digits as Caitlyn Scott (White Plains, N.Y.) and Diamond White (Hamden, Conn.) each netted 17, while Murray-Leach made 15 and Amanda Zdru (Stratford, Conn.) posted 12.

HOW IT HAPPENED

  • In the opening seconds, Amya Moss swished for three off the side pass from Makiah Scott to put the visitors up, 3-0, which lasted four and a half minutes before Murray-Leach drove to the basket for a layup and put Albertus on the board.
  • Scott notched a deep three-point bucket and ignited a 15-9 Albertus run to knot the contest at 17 a piece to close out the first quarter. White dominated the hardwood during the run with a pair of back-to-back threes.
  • Less than a minute into the second quarter, Kathleen Rodriguez regained the lead for NEC until a trio of free throws and a three-pointer by Zdru put the hosts up, 23-19.
  • The teams traded baskets for the remaining six minutes until Murray-Leach's jumpshot with seven seconds left in the half put Albertus up, 33-31.
  • Back-to-back layups by Scott and White opened the third quarter and padded the Falcons' lead by six.
  • Four-straight layups by Natasha Rivera (Ansonia, Conn.), Murray Leach, and Scott ignited a 13-2 run to push the lead margin to 13 with 49 seconds remaining in the third quarter. NEC closed out the quarter with five unanswered points to cut the deficit to eight with Albertus up, 53-45.
  • Zdru and White each netted a three-pointer in the final quarter and helped maintain the Albertus lead.
